Precision Imaging: A New Era

At the heart of this technological marvel is LLNL’s cutting-edge optical telescope system, ready to soar into orbit aboard Firefly’s Elytra platform. The capability to capture images at a stunning 0.2-meter resolution from a 50-kilometer altitude will unlock unprecedented detail in lunar imaging. This initiative marks not only a technical achievement but a symbolic return of LLNL to lunar orbit since their work on the famed Clementine mission.

According to Space Daily, the precision of this telescope will enable detailed mineral mapping and optimal landing site selection, among other scientific endeavors.

Commercial Skywatching with Ocula

Firefly’s Elytra Dark, the initial serving as a transfer stage for the Blue Ghost Mission 2, will remain in lunar orbit for over five years. Utilizing the high-grade imagery from LLNL’s telescope, it supports both scientific research and operational missions. The innovation doesn’t stop there; plans for further missions, like Blue Ghost Mission 3 in 2028, underscore this long-term vision.

Lunar Science with Practical Applications

Remarkably, the dual-band imaging feature can detect ilmenite, a mineral linked to helium-3, thereby potentially opening doors to new energy sources. The foresight in the mission extends to long-term astronomical events, offering a rich database of lunar activity such as the projected 2032 asteroid flyby.
